HC Deb 25 January 1993 vol 217 c578W
Mr. Wigley

To ask the Secretary of State for Wales what is the current rate of unemployment among(a) disabled people in total and (b) disabled people of working age in Wales.

Mr. David Hunt

Information on those with a health problem or disability which limits the kind of paid work they can do is available from the labour force survey, but is only collected for people of working age. It is estimated that, in the summer of 1992, 7 per cent. of such people were unemployed according to the International Labour Organisation definition. A further 12 per cent. said they would like a job but were not currently looking for work. These estimates are based on very small samples in Wales and may be subject to large sampling variability.
